Mission

THE KEYSTONE ENERGY EFFICIENCY ALLIANCE (KEEA) IS A 501(C)(6) TRADE ASSOCIATION REPRESENTING THE INTERESTS OF ENERGY EFFICIENCY BUSINESSES IN PENNSYLVANIA AND NEW JERSEY. KEEA ENGAGES WITH LEGISLATORS AND REGULATORY BODIES TO ADVANCE ENERGY EFFICIENCY POLICIES AT THE LOCAL, STATE, AND FEDERAL LEVELS. THE MISSION OF THE KEYSTONE ENERGY EFFICIENCY ALLIANCE IS TO CHAMPION EFFICIENCY AS THE FOUNDATION OF A CLEAN, JUST, AND RESILIENT ENERGY ECONOMY.

Pay in context

Top pay as a share of expenses

In 2024, the highest total compensation at KEYSTONE ENERGY EFFICIENCY ALLIANCE equaled 13% of the organization's total expenses. The median for community improvement & capacity building organizations is 14%.

This organization (2024)
13%
Sector median
14%
Middle half of sector
6% to 28%

Based on 10,247 community improvement & capacity building organizations, each measured at its most recent filing year with reported expenses and compensation.
